Description

File protection bag and folder
Technical Field
The present application relates to flexible packaging bag technology, and in particular, to a file protection bag and a file folder.
Background
At present, a file protection bag is commonly used for placing and protecting files or cards, the existing file protection bag at least comprises two layers of protection films, the two layers of protection films form an upper opening or a side opening, protected objects such as business cards, photos, files and the like can be inserted into the file protection bag in a straight insertion mode or a side insertion mode, and the two layers of protection films are respectively attached to the front side and the back side of the protected objects to play a role in protection.
However, the conventional document protection pouch has the following drawbacks:
(1) The protection Film of some file protection bags adopts single material, if some file protection bags use OPP Film (Oriented Polypropylene Film), can make the internal surface of file protection bag take place adhesion, glutinous mouthful, and resistance is great when inserting the protection object, even the unable opening of inserting of protection object.
(2) The common file protection bag in the market at present is a PP Film (Polypropylene Film) formed by a Film blowing process, and has the defects of low transparency and difficulty in meeting the requirement of laser pattern effect.
(3) In order to avoid the adhesion of the inner surface of the document protection bag and enable the document protection bag to have better stiffness, the protective film structure of part of the document protection bag is more complex, for example, part of manufacturers compress a layer of multilayer composite film with better comprehensive performance by using various materials such as OPP film, kraft paper, other PP films and the like, and the multilayer composite film is used for processing the document protection bag, and the document protection bag has the problems of complex processing technology and higher production cost.

Compared with the prior art, the beneficial effect of this application lies in:
the holding chamber both sides of file protection bag are the OPP membrane respectively, the CPP membrane, at first the OPP membrane has better deflection, and the transparency is higher, make the inside visual of file protection bag, secondly the CPP membrane is softer, be difficult for with the adhesion of OPP membrane, can prevent to take place glutinous mouthful, reduce the resistance when inserting the protection object, the OPP membrane makes the non-adhesion of file protection bag with CPP membrane combined action, glutinous mouthful not, easily insert paper, effectively compensate the too soft problem of CPP membrane, furthermore, compare the file protection bag that multilayer complex film was processed, the file protection bag of this application still has the structure fairly simply, advantage that the processing cost is low.

The file protection bag shown in fig. 1 comprises an OPP film 10 and a CPP film 20, wherein the OPP film 10 is provided with a first connecting part, the CPP film 20 is provided with a second connecting part corresponding to the first connecting part, the first connecting part and the second connecting part are connected to form a containing cavity 30 for placing a protected object, and an opening for allowing the protected object to enter the containing cavity 30.
The OPP film 10 has strong viscosity, if the upper layer and the lower layer of the document protection bag are both the OPP film 10, the inner surface of the document protection bag can be adhered to cause an adhesive opening, so that a protected object cannot be inserted into the accommodating cavity 30; if the upper and lower layers of the file protection bag both use other PP films, the transparency and the stiffness of the file protection bag are not enough; the file protection bag that forms through the laminating of OPP membrane 10 and CPP membrane 20 utilizes OPP membrane 10 to have improved the deflection, and because OPP membrane 10 transparency is higher, make the protection object visual, be convenient for distinguish the object of placing in the different file protection bags, through using softer, the CPP membrane 20 that viscosity is lower relatively, the problem of adhesion has easily appeared between two-layer OPP membrane 10 has been solved, more do benefit to the slip sheet, and file protection bag overall structure is simpler, and the processing cost is lower.
In a preferred embodiment, the first connecting portion and the second connecting portion are formed by hot press molding or ultrasonic molding, and the ultrasonic molding can make the connection between the first connecting portion and the second connecting portion stronger.
The basic shape of the accommodating cavity 30 is square, the first connecting portion and the second connecting portion are connected to form a first pressing edge 41, a second pressing edge 42, and a third pressing edge 43, two ends of the first pressing edge 41 are respectively connected to the opening and the second pressing edge 42, the second pressing edge 42 is located at the bottom of the accommodating cavity 30, and the third pressing edge 43 and the first pressing edge 41 are symmetrically arranged about the second pressing edge 42.
The basic shape of the file protection bag is rectangular, the dotted line part indicates a first pressing edge 41, a second pressing edge 42 and a third pressing edge 43, the opening is arranged at the top of the file protection bag, the first pressing edge 41 is arranged along the length direction of the file protection bag, the second pressing edge 42 is arranged along the width direction of the file protection bag, and the opening is arranged at the top of the file protection bag, so that the protected object can be effectively prevented from being accidentally pulled out of the accommodating cavity 30.
At least one of the first, second and third press- fit sides 41, 42 and 43 is provided with a binding part 44, the binding part 44 is used for binding the document protection bag, and the arrangement of the binding part 44 facilitates the induction and arrangement of the document protection bag.
The binding part 44 is arranged on the first pressing edge 41, and a plurality of file protection bags can be bound into a book along the length direction, which is more suitable for the reading habit.
The OPP film 10 is provided with a first open side 11, the CPP film 20 is provided with a second open side 21, the first open side 11 and the second open side 21 surround to form an opening, and the length of the first open side 11 is larger than or equal to that of the second open side 21, so that the gap between the first open side 11 and the second open side 21 is increased, and the insertion of a protection object is more convenient.
OPP membrane 10 and/or CPP membrane 20 are radium-shine membrane, and OPP membrane 10 is compared in other PP membranes, is changeed and processes out radium-shine flash effect to radium-shine stamp can not fade and drop, and OPP membrane 10 is radium-shine membrane in the attached figure 1 to radium-shine stamp is represented to irregular cubic shade, and in addition, specific radium-shine stamp can be used to sign and anti-fake, and two sides can not all have radium-shine face certainly, formulate as required.
The file protection bag at least comprises one layer of OPP film 10 and one layer of CPP film 20, the one layer of OPP film 10 and the one layer of CPP film 20 are attached to form the file protection bag with a single containing cavity 30, the two layers of OPP films 10 are respectively arranged on two sides of the one layer of CPP film 20, the file protection bag with double containing cavities 30 can be formed, and by analogy, the OPP films 10 and the CPP films 20 are alternately arranged to form a multilayer file protection bag with more than two containing cavities 30.
The basic thickness of the OPP film 10 is 0.03mm to 0.1mm, the basic thickness of the CPP film 20 is 0.03mm to 0.1mm, and the basic thickness of the OPP film 10 is the same as or different from the basic thickness of the CPP film 20.
The thickness of the OPP film is about 0.03mm, 0.04mm, 0.05mm, 0.06mm, 0.07mm, 0.08mm, 0.09mm, 0.1mm, the thickness of the CPP film is about 0.03mm, 0.04mm, 0.05mm, 0.06mm, 0.07mm, 0.08mm, 0.09mm, 0.1mm, the thickness of the OPP film may be the same as or different from that of the CPP film.
